** 안드로이드 스튜디오 버전 Bumblebee (Arctic Fox 이후 버전) 버전을 기준으로 작성되었습니다. Kakao SDK 설정하기1 - 프로젝트 설정 settings.gradle 파일에 카카오 SDK 라이브러리를 추가한다. dependencyResolutionManagement { repositoriesMode.set(RepositoriesMode.FAIL_ON_PROJECT_REPOS) repositories { google() mavenCentral() //kakao SDK 설정 (카카오 로그인) maven { url 'https://devrepo.kakao.com/nexus/content/groups/public/' } } } build.gradle(Module단) 에 모듈 설정 depe..
Android/API
맨 처음 참고했던 글 https://kumgo1d.tistory.com/69 [Android/Kotlin] Kakao 로컬(주소 검색) API 사용하기 안녕하세요 골드입니다. 오늘은 카카오 로컬 API를 사용하는 방법에 대해서 글을 쓰려고 합니다. 카카오 로컬 api는 지도와 관련된 기능을 가지고 있으며, 다양한 기능을 가지고 있습니다. 예를 kumgo1d.tistory.com 최소한의 코드와 차근차근 설명이 좋았던 글 https://choheeis.github.io/newblog//articles/2019-12/%EB%A0%88%ED%8A%B8%EB%A1%9C%ED%95%8F%EC%82%AC%EC%9A%A9%ED%95%B4%EB%B3%B4%EA%B8%B0 [안드로이드] 💻 Retrofit 사용하여 서버..
관광공사의 Tour Api 국문관광정보 활용 작업 중 Retrofit 으로 api와 통신하는 과정에서 해결이 어려웠던 오류 W/System.err: com.google.gson.JsonSyntaxException: java.lang.IllegalStateException: Expected BEGIN_OBJECT but was STRING at line 1 column 79 path $.response.body.items json 데이터를 받아오는 데 받아오는 json내용 중간에 { }가 아닌 [ ]로 감싸진 배열형태가 존재 그 부분에서 에러가 남 에러 메세지 내용 : Expected BEGIN_OBJECT but was STRING.. 즉 { }가 올 자리에 [ ]가 있어서 오류가 났다 json의 이런 ..
카카오맵 api를 활용해서 원하는 좌표상 위치를 지도의 중심점으로 설정하고 마커를 표시하자 ** 이 글은 아래 글과 이어진다. 카카오맵 사용 시작부터 알고 싶다면 아래 링크 참고 https://onedaythreecoding.tistory.com/7 [Android/Kotlin] 카카오맵 KakaoMap API 시작하기 : MapView, 초기설정 카카오맵으로 안드로이드 앱에 지도 띄우기 카카오 공식 문서만 보고 해보려다가 처음 해보는 사람 입장에서는 모르는 부분들이 꽤나 있어 도움이 되고자 글쓴다. 결과물 1. SDK파일 다운로드 카 onedaythreecoding.tistory.com 결과물 activity_main.xml MainActivity.kt package com.example.kakaoma..
카카오맵으로 안드로이드 앱에 지도 띄우기 카카오 공식 문서만 보고 해보려다가 처음 해보는 사람 입장에서는 모르는 부분들이 꽤나 있어 도움이 되고자 글쓴다. 결과물 1. SDK파일 다운로드 카카오 공식문서에서 DownLoad SDK 버튼을 눌러 다운받고 압축을 푼다. 위치는 상관 없다. 카카오 공식 문서 : https://apis.map.kakao.com/android/guide/ 2. 카카오 개발자 사이트 - 개발자 등록, 앱 생성 개발자 사이트 https://developers.kakao.com/ 에서 개발자등록을 하고 앱을 생성한다. 내 안드로이드 프로젝트 파일의 패키지명이 필요하다. 패키지명은 프로젝트 파일 중 AndroidManifest.xml 상단에서 확인할 수 있다. ** 내 프로젝트의 디버그..